Why do people love Beaumont? It’s the people! Southern charm, Texas pride and neighbors helping neighbors. Beaumont has a small town atmosphere with big city amenities which allows newcomers to make connections and quickly feel at home in their new hometown. Beaumont is a cultural melting pot of people and cuisine, from Seafood to Soul food, where Cajun meets Texas barbecue and Tex Mex. 10% lower housing costs and cost of living is 7% below the national average. Centrally located to daytime and weekend getaways such as Houston, beaches of the Gulf of Mexico, San Antonio and New Orleans! Moderate climate makes outdoor living a way of life with a plethora of Neches River activities including boating, fishing, kayaking, canoeing. Cattail Marsh in Tyrrell Park is a featured site on the Great Texas Coastal Birding Trail and Big Thicket is home to numerous hiking trails and camping sites. Various sporting activities including a number of golf courses, active running clubs, equestrian and gymnastics schools for kids, and outdoor tennis and basketball courts. Outstanding medical facilities Varied educational opportunities for a family's choices including charter, private and parochial schools. Higher educational facilities are unrivaled with area technical and two-year colleges, as well as exceptional bachelor, masters, and doctoral programs at Lamar University. Regular community activities with art exhibits, more museums per capita than any other Texas city, and local farmers markets. Welcoming to artists and a budding Downtown Beaumont Cultural Arts District, Beaumont is home to a number of professional and community performing arts organizations including theatre, dance, and the Symphony of Southeast Texas. Families who value religious affiliations can find a home in a wonderful array of churches, temples, a synagogue; with Beaumont being home to historic Greek Orthodox, Catholic, a Jewish synagogue, and multiple protestant churches.
